PSLF Eligible | Brand-New 144-Bed Behavioral Health Hospital

Fairview is seeking a Physician Assistant – Adult Psychiatry InpatientΒ to join our growing inpatient team at the newly opened Capitol Park Mental Health Hospital in St. Paul, Minnesota.

This state-of-the-art, 144-bed behavioral health hospital was purpose-built to support patients with acute mental health needs in a safe, therapeutic, and recovery-focused environment. As our program continues to expand, providers have the opportunity to help shape scheduling, workflow, and clinical program development in collaboration with engaged hospital leadership.

Practice Highlights

  • Full-Time (1.0 FTE)Β 

  • Structured, team-based coverage model ensuring 24/7 continuity of care

  • Shared call rotation supported by hospitalists and moonlighters

  • Dedicated support to promote sustainable workloads

  • Multidisciplinary treatment teams including nursing, therapy, and social work

  • Participation in daily interdisciplinary rounds

  • Opportunity to contribute to quality improvement initiatives and program growth

  • Strong administrative and clinical leadership committed to provider well-being

Scheduling continues to evolve as the team grows, with a focus on flexibility and maintaining manageable inpatient volumes.

Qualifications:

  • Graduate of an accredited Physician Assistant program

  • Board Certified or Board Eligible (BC/BE) through the NCCPA

  • Licensed or eligible for licensure as a Physician Assistant with the Minnesota Board of Medical Practice

  • Ability to obtain and/or maintain DEA certification for the State of Minnesota

  • Must meet credentialing and privileging criteria/qualifications

  • BLS certification required

  • Previous experience in acute care, adolescent care, and/or geriatric care preferred

  • Experience in an inpatient psychiatric setting is required
